Can't change the brightness settings of my Versa 4

ANSWERED
Replies are disabled for this topic. Start a new one or visit our Help Center.

When trying to change settings I.e. display brightness, it will not allow me to change. Also will not let me change awake to motion and button.

Hi there, @PJDeuel74. Welcome to the Community Forums. Thanks for the details provided in your post about the issue with your Versa 4.

 it seems that you've set your Versa 3 into Sleep Mode. When the sleep mode setting is on:

  • Notifications, goal celebrations, and reminders to move are muted.
  • The screen's brightness is set to dim.
  • The Always-On Display clock face is turned off.
  • The screen stays dark when you turn your wrist.
  • The sleep mode icon illuminates in the quick settings.

To turn off Sleep Mode, please swipe down from the clock face on your watch to access the quick settings.. For more information, see How do I navigate my Fitbit device?

I set mine to 'Max' and it goes bright. I put my wrist down and lift it back up and the screen is dim again ?

The setting does not seem to stay applied. Any ideas please. Cheers.

Hi @Simonsimps - you can try restarting the watch but the brightness settings have a mind of their own. However when you pull down on the watch to get to Quick Settings make sure all the other icons are off before changing brightness which can also be changed in the watch Settings. You may notice that changing brightness causes the watch to flash once.
